  • Is sheet vinyl waterproof?

    Yes, sheet vinyl is water-resistant and performs very well in moisture-prone areas like bathrooms, laundries and kitchens. Its continuous surface makes it more water-tight than planks or tiles, as there are fewer joins where water can seep through. However, while the material itself resists water, professional installation is key to sealing edges and protecting subfloors from long-term exposure.

  • How long does sheet vinyl last?

    With proper care and installation, sheet vinyl flooring can last anywhere from 10 to 20 years. Its lifespan depends on foot traffic, cleaning habits, and the quality of the product. Thicker wear layers will provide better resistance to scratches and dents. It’s a good option for households wanting a budget-friendly floor that still offers reliable durability over time.

  • Can you install sheet vinyl over tiles or concrete?

    Yes, sheet vinyl can often be laid over existing tiles or concrete as long as the surface is level, dry and in good condition. We may need to use levelling compound to create a smooth base. This prep work helps avoid visible imperfections and ensures a long-lasting finish. It's a great way to refresh your space without full floor removal.

Practical, Seamless Coverage

Sheet vinyl is a resilient flooring option made from a layered construction that’s both water-resistant and comfortable underfoot. It comes in large sheets, typically 2 to 4 metres wide, allowing us to install it with fewer seams than other flooring types.


This makes it an excellent choice for wet or high-use areas. It’s slip-resistant, quiet to walk on, and suitable for homes with kids, pets, or anyone wanting hassle-free flooring.
